The night belongs to the barn owl and, if you’re very lucky, you might catch a glimpse of one of these wonderful birds as it hunts for its supper.
I’m fortunate enough to have observed them several times, most often on the banks of the River Witham in Lincolnshire, England.
This is my latest depiction of the beautiful barn owl, this time in flight during a night patrol as it hunts for its prey.
It’s painted in professional oil paints on high quality canvas.
The wonderful Mistle Thrush. Spotted one winter by the side of the Oxford Canal in England, no doubt hunting for snails and other tasty treats.
A professionally printed Giclee print on 300gsm matt paper. Giclee prints are of a much higher quality and durability than inkjet or laser prints. They are true archival quality, with accurate colour matching to the original artwork.
Signed by the artist.
Size - 30x30cm with a white border.
A grouse in full flight observed in flight one winter on the North Yorkshire moors.
I drove up a track onto a North Yorkshire moorland in my Land Rover, with permission of the landowner and gamekeeper of course, to sketch and photograph grouse on the moors.
This print is from one of a series of paintings I did from my observations that week.
